Bizarre state government policies

From the SCRANTON TIMES-TRIBUNE Editorial:

Pennsylvania’s government continues to walk away from readily available revenue while slashing funding for education and vital social services.

Republican majorities in both houses and Gov. Tom Corbett will not impose a fair tax on the natural gas industry. It continues to allow a massive reporting loophole that enables 70 percent of the corporations doing business in the commonwealth to report their income elsewhere. And it will not mandate sales tax payments by online retailers…

A bill in the U.S. Senate, the Marketplace Fairness Act, would require all online retailers to collect the sales. Sens. Bob Casey and Pat Toomey should support the legislation…
